As a homeowner in Douglas, how can I tell if my HVAC system needs repair or replacement?
We recommend scheduling a professional inspection if you notice rising energy bills, uneven heating or cooling, strange noises, or frequent cycling. For systems over 10-15 years old, a replacement with a modern, energy-efficient unit may be more cost-effective. Our licensed technicians in Douglas can assess your system's performance, explain your options clearly, and help you choose the best solution for your home and budget, whether it's a repair or a new installation.

Why is outdoor condenser coil corrosion a common issue for HVAC systems in Douglas, and how do you address it?
The humid, coastal-influenced air in southeast Georgia can accelerate corrosion on outdoor condenser coils. This buildup reduces efficiency and can lead to system failure. During our preventative maintenance visits, our technicians carefully clean the coils to remove debris and inspect for early signs of corrosion. We can apply protective coatings if needed and recommend strategic placement or protective covers to help shield your unit from the elements, preserving its performance and longevity.
